61 Sidley Lawyers Recognized in Chambers Global: The World’s Leading Lawyers for Business for 2010

March 18, 2010

New York - Chambers Global: The World’s Leading Lawyers for Business has named 61 lawyers from Sidley Austin LLP as leaders in their field in their 2010 guide. In addition to lawyer rankings, the Chambers guide ranks practices on a global, regional and jurisdictional basis. Sidley ranked in a total of 54 practice areas in 14 jurisdictions (including global and regional), with 15 receiving number one rankings. Sidley also received 77 lawyer rankings for 61 recognized lawyers, including 19 number one rankings and one “Up and Coming” ranking.

The U.K.-based international publisher Chambers and Partners based its report on in-depth interviews with leading private practice lawyers and key in-house counsel. A team of over 50 full-time researchers conducted the survey with law firms and lawyers chosen on merit only.
